How is your site or web page ranked?

producing your site indexed by the search engines is the first phase of the SEO process. How this works is that search engines find your website or web page through the use of different indexing programs, such as crawlers or spiders that basically abide by all links that lead to your website or page and downloads copies of it as it goes.

After this, your site or page will be examined and indexed based on some algorithms and criteria set by the search engines, thereby giving your site its ranking. Links from other websites that incorporate comparable and pertinent information are one of the best methods to see your page rank improve.

Avoid spamming

Spamming is one way of achieving visitors directed to your site. Nevertheless, this type of technique will only work for a short time period, and will in the end lead to your website’s failure.

This kind of method works by literally tricking traffic to get redirected to your site through the use of a number of deceptive techniques, such as using immaterial keywords and employing duplicate subject matter on other sites just to attempt and increase your site’s page ranking. Initially, this are able to generate some traffic to your website, but it will create a number of issues later on for your website, making it a big possibility that you might even lose a number of potential clients along the way.

Surfing

Every time you spend some pleasurable moments surfing the web, you are actually exposing your own data to the rest of the world. It does not necessarily require malware or virus to exist in order for this to happen. Specifically information that is easily available online includes your IP address, your country (and often more location information based on IP address), what computer system you are on, what browser you use, your browser history, and other information. Take comfort that you can actually surf the web anonymously if you wish. None of the recommended ways are totally foolproof but they do offer some form of protection. You can benefit from anonymous proxy servers They are great to hide your own IP. This has the effect of masking your IP address and making it much harder for people to track you.

Where can we get proxy severs? You can purchase a proxy server form vendor. Try using one of the many proxy services online. Two such products are ShadowSurf and Guardster. One service you can use at no charge is ShadowSurf. Access the site and enter a URL that you want to keep anonymous. Those are the most widely used tools to help you remain anonymous.
